1939 The National Parks Preserve WildlifeArtwork By: J. Hirt Date of Original: 1939 (published) New York, NY Original Size: 26 x 20 inches This is a fine print reproduction of a stunning vintage poster promoting wildlife preservation through the National Parks. The illustration shows a pair of bighorn sheep perched atop a rocky cliff, overlooking a mountain lake at sunset. The poster was produced by the Works Progress Administration Federal Art Project.
